Abstract: | ![]() A polypyrrole electrode with ferrocene mediator is prepared and its sensitivity to hydrogen peroxide is investigated. The polypyrrole is deposited upon a 0.5 cm2 Pt plate by the polymerization of pyrrole by scanning the electrode potential between 0.0 and 0.9 V at a scan rate of 50 mV/s. The platinum/polypyrrole-ferrocene (Pt/PPy-Fc) electrode is prepared by adding ferrocene to the coverage medium. The electrode’s sensitivity to hydrogen peroxide is investigated at room temperature using 0.025 M phosphate buffer at pH 7. The working potential is 0.7 V, the concentrations of pyrrole and ferrocene are 0.2 M and 10 mM. Polypyrrole was coated on the electrode surface within 26 cycles.
